Katy Perry is really taking the woke-pop movement seriously. The Brit Awards-conquering diva shared a new snippet on Instagram today (February 28) and it’s distinctly political in nature. “I won’t no, I won’t apologize,” she chants. “I will not, will not subscribe. Don’t ask me, ask me to normalize.” It’s not accompanied by music, which has Katy Cats wondering if it’s part of a campaign for an upcoming protest as opposed to a taste of KP4. Whatever the case may be, kudos to the “Chained To The Rhythm” hitmaker for fighting the good fight.

Speaking of Katy’s woke bop, “Chained To The Rhythm” is shaping up to be an important milestone in her career. She already waved goodbye to the light and fluffy pop of Teenage Dream on Prism (listen to the second half), but this takes her artistry to a whole new level. Happily, fans seem to be going along for the ride. The track debuted at number 4 on the Billboard Hot 100 and is still lodged in the iTunes top 10.
